Jomon (iou)



Jomon adjective. M20.
[Japanese jomon cord mark.]
Designating an early handmade earthenware pottery found in Japan and freq. decorated with impressed rope patterns. Also, designating the early neolithic or pre-neolithic culture characterized by this pottery.

linable (iou)



linable adjective. Also lineable. L17.
[from LINE noun2 or verb2 + -ABLE.]
(Able to be) ranged in a straight line.
